Anatomy of a Scratch

To address the issue, one must first understand the anatomy of a scratch. These imperfections are more than just surface-level lines; they are physical alterations to the vinyl substrate and the delicate groove walls. A deep scratch can gouge the surface, creating a valley that the stylus cannot properly traverse, while a shallow micro-scratch creates friction that manifests as high-frequency noise. The severity is often determined by depth, length, and orientation relative to the groove direction.

Causes and Culprits

Most vinyl record scratches occur due to handling errors or environmental factors. Dust and grit act as an abrasive when the record spins, grinding against the stylus and carving tiny paths into the vinyl. Rough needle drops or aggressive arm returns can carve a visible line across the track. Even storing records vertically without proper support can lead to deformation where the weight of the record creates stress lines that eventually turn into audible scratches during playback.

The Sonic Impact

Not all damage sounds the same. The specific sound of a vinyl record scratch depends entirely on the nature of the groove damage. A sharp edge creates a sudden transient spike, resulting in a loud "crack" or "pop." A more elongated scrape, however, produces a sustained "hiss" or "rattle" as the stylus vibrates uncontrollably for the duration of the defect. Engineers sometimes refer to this as "rumble" if it is low-frequency noise caused by debris caught in the groove.

Aesthetic and Artistic Value

Interestingly, what was once a defect has been elevated to a feature in modern music production. Producers intentionally layer vinyl crackle and simulated scratches onto tracks to evoke nostalgia or add texture to a beat. In the world of DJing, the deliberate "back-cueing" technique—scratching the record back and forth against the needle—turns a potential disaster into a rhythmic instrument. The imperfection becomes the message.

Collector Considerations

For the physical collector, the presence of scratches dictates the grading and value of a release. A grading standard like the Goldmine grading scale provides a common language, distinguishing between "Mint" (M) records with zero surface noise and "Good Plus" (G+) records that exhibit moderate wear. While a light haze might be acceptable for a common pop record, deep scratches on a rare audiophile pressing can render the object sonically and financially obsolete.
